Output 538f75f38a9315fab1d624e077ea557caf38077b027dfd045589df62194ef2f2:2

value
10486297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a6efebf59a41f7ef34e4403168abfbf9248088c OP_EQUAL
address
M8rKxRXjpi7vLztrx1Sw71qqEL8cA34nBP
transaction
538f75f38a9315fab1d624e077ea557caf38077b027dfd045589df62194ef2f2
spent
true